Output 0dac84f83824075afd1f80201738b7cbfdaf41a7580b30aa0518b63396bb6500:2

value
99974695
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db07ac54c59b214c11cc7c0da7ab7e13dc22c912 OP_EQUAL
address
MTsHQaib9217qHcnBk5aVCfW2sJnzwyFGw
transaction
0dac84f83824075afd1f80201738b7cbfdaf41a7580b30aa0518b63396bb6500
spent
true